Digital Image Stabilization Based on Phase Correlation

Abstract :
In this paper, we present a method for digital image stabilization based on Fourier-Mellin transform and phase correlation. We acquire the rotating angle and scaling factor firstly by phase correlation between Fourier-Mellin transform images of the reference and observed images. After rotating and scaling the observed image, implement the phase correlation again to compute the spacial translation. Because of spectral periodicity, the correlation between Fourier-Mellin transform images will be weaken and maybe lead to wrong result when the rotating angle is close to 90°. So we add a coarse search before phase correlation to avoid this situation. And we use a smooth window to reduce the noise in phase correlation. Furthermore, a coordinate mapping chart is recommended to avoid the unnecessary computation cost during creating log-polar image. The experiment results show the proposed method can acquire accurate motion parameters between two adjacent frames.
